Senior Program Manager, Navy Fire Control Radar Production

$145,600–$276,800 year

On-siteEl Segundo, California, United States

Full TimeSenior LevelDoctorate Or Professional DegreeEnterpriseAEROSPACE

Job Summary

Conduct daily interfaces with customers and engineering teams to communicate financial status, engineering progress, issues, and opportunities. Execute risk and opportunity management plans to meet program commitments while developing technology roadmaps and working closely with the customer. Lead capture activities including proposals, win strategies, cost estimating, and gates, and ensure comprehensive execution of annual and five-year business plans. Travel up to 25% based on business needs. Requires active Secret U.S. government security clearance, onsite location in El Segundo, CA, and 10+ years of program management experience.
